Czestochowa vs Muharraq Climate & Distance Between

Bahrain flag
  • The distance between Czestochowa, Poland and Muharraq, Bahrain is approximately 3,817 km or 2,372 mi.
  • To reach Czestochowa in this distance one would set out from Muharraq bearing 324.1°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Czestochowa bearing 303.7° or WNW .
  • Czestochowa has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Muharraq has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• The mean temperature is 18.8 °C (33.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.1 °C (5.6°F) more in Czestochowa.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 541.2 mm (21.3 in) more which is equivalent to 541.2 l/m² (13.28 US gal/ft²) or 5,412,000 l/ha (578,579 US gal/ac) more. About 8 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24.5° lower in Czestochowa than in Muharraq.
